Understanding Hair Cloning: The Future of Hair Restoration

Hair cloning is a highly advanced medical procedure that involves replicating hair follicle cells in a laboratory setting to produce new, healthy hair follicles. Unlike traditional hair transplant methods that transfer existing follicles, hair cloning aims to multiply these follicles exponentially, offering an unlimited supply of donor hair. This technology holds the promise to effectively treat extensive hair loss, including androgenetic alopecia and other hair thinning conditions, with remarkable precision and natural results.

How Does Hair Cloning Work?

The process involves several meticulously conducted steps:

  • Extraction of Donor Cells: A small tissue sample is obtained from the patient's scalp, ensuring compatibility and minimizing rejection risk.
  • Cell Cultivation and Multiplication: Hair follicle stem cells are isolated and cultivated in specialized laboratory environments, where they are rapidly multiplied to generate a large pool of hair follicle progenitor cells.
  • Reimplantation: The multiplied cells are then carefully injected or implanted into the bald or thinning areas of the scalp, encouraging the growth of new hair follicles.
  • Growth and Development: Over a few months, these cells develop into full-fledged hair follicles, producing natural, robust hair.

The Scientific Foundations of Hair Cloning and Its Biological Significance

The core principle behind hair cloning is rooted in hair follicle biology and stem cell science. Hair follicles are complex mini-organs with a remarkable regenerative capacity, primarily driven by follicle stem cells located in the bulge area of each follicle. Researchers have long hypothesized that by isolating and expanding these stem cells outside the body, they could generate an abundant source of new hair follicle units.

The potential of hair cloning is supported by recent advances in:

  • Stem Cell Technology: Enhancing the ability to harvest and multiply follicular stem cells efficiently.
  • Regenerative Medicine: Developing safe and effective methods to stimulate natural hair growth pathways.
  • Biotechnology: Utilizing tissue engineering and biofabrication to create structured hair follicle units.

Challenges and Future Prospects of Hair Cloning

While hair cloning holds immense promise, several challenges must be addressed to facilitate widespread adoption:

  • Technical Limitations: Refining cell culture techniques to sustain hair follicle viability and functionality.
  • Cost Considerations: Making treatments affordable to ensure accessibility for a broader audience.
  • Regulatory Hurdles: Meeting stringent safety and efficacy standards imposed by health authorities.
  • Long-Term Efficacy: Demonstrating consistent, natural growth over extended periods.

Despite these hurdles, ongoing research and technological innovations continue to accelerate progress, positioning hair cloning as a mainstream treatment within the next decade.
